Output bd24185ffc79b8f9390a19e7f2aa9c7aac418d14c71ed39f626fc1e8a9739533:1

value
2998600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8ff5159d7b1369395fee1d312d551f35d2698e4 OP_EQUAL
address
3QPbMucGeWG8KZzAxG9hZpNGNFaCDLLBR6
transaction
bd24185ffc79b8f9390a19e7f2aa9c7aac418d14c71ed39f626fc1e8a9739533
spent
true